N216 YDU is a 1996 Rover 111 in Red with a 1,120cc petrol engine. This vehicle has been through 21 MOT tests with a personal pass rate of 71.4%.
Across all 1996 Rover 111 models, the average MOT pass rate is 62.8% with a typical mileage of 50,665 miles. This particular vehicle has performed better than the average for its year.
The most common reason a Rover 111 fails its MOT is seat belt anchorage prescribed area is excessively corroded, accounting for 15,216 recorded failures. If you're considering buying N216 YDU, it's worth having these areas checked by a mechanic before committing.
The Rover 111 typically stays on UK roads for around 31 years. At 30 years old, this Rover 111 is approaching the upper end of the typical lifespan for this model.
